Since installing Snow Leopard, Moneywell no longer opens the last file when I start the program. I double checked and I DO have "Open last document on startup" checked in the prefs.

Each time I start the new user wizard pops up and I have to manually select my data file. Also noticed the File/Open Recent menu shows no entries.

    I fixed it! It is caused by Snow Leopard.

    In the OS X Appearance pref pane there is a setting for number of recent items. I had all three settings set to "None". By changing the Documents setting to 5 it fixed the problem with Moneywell. (see my screen cap)

    I want to stress that I did not change this setting since going to Snow Leopard. I have always had all three of these set to None in Leopard and just left them the same in Snow.

    Apparently something about the way Snow handles this broke the "Open last document..." feature in Moneywell.

    Peter: Thanks for discovering this, I'm not used to hearing people changing this to none. In MoneyWell 1.4, it needs this list to open the last file. In 1.5, there will be a way to create an open files set (I always open a business and personal document when I run MoneyWell so it's tough for me to have just one automatic one open).
